The WHO encourages everyone to use these new names to prevent discrimination and stigma. The names will replace informal place names for four variants of concern and six variants of interest – but the scientific letter and number labels will remain in use by scientists.

Variants of concern

• Alpha: Kent – B.1.1.7
• Beta: South Africa – B.1.351
• Gamma: Brazil – P.1
• Delta: India – B.1.617.2

Variants of interest

• Epsilon: US – B.1.427 & B.1.429
• Zeta: Brazil – P.2
• Eta: Various places – B.1.525
• Theta: Philippines – P.3
• Iota: US – B.1.526
• Kappa: India – B.1.617.1
